Which of the following branches of philosophy does NOT involve questions related
to values?
Select one:
a. Moral
b. Metaphysics
c. Social
d. Political - ANSWER: B
In philosophy, what is an argument?
Select one:
a. a factual disagreement between people
b. giving reasons for a belief
c. a shouting match
d. any verbal attempt to persuade - ANSWER: B
The fallacy of _____ amounts to transferring the qualities of a spokesperson to his or
her insights, arguments, beliefs, or positions.
Select one:
a. red herring
b. begging the question
c. straw man
d. argumentum ad hominem - ANSWER: D
Thinking that a person's position is frightening because the person himself is
frightening would be an obvious mistake in reasoning. This is an example of the
fallacy of _____.
Select one:
a. argumentum ad hominem
b. switching the burden of proof
c. false dilemma
d. reductio ad absurdum - ANSWER: A
Thales, Anaximenes, and Anaximander are collectively known as the _____.
Select one:
a. Atomists
b. Pythagoreans
c. Milesians
d. Particle Theorists - ANSWER: C
, Metaphysics is the branch of philosophy concerned with the nature and
fundamental properties of _____.
Select one:
a. knowledge
b. god
c. beauty
d. being - ANSWER: D
Which of the following statements is true about Anaxagoras?
Select one:
a. He introduced into metaphysics an important distinction, that between matter
and mind.
b. He thought that basic particles were indivisible.
c. He held that there were four different kinds of particles.
d. He believed that particles were always in motion. - ANSWER: A
Who among the following were regarded as the Atomists?
Select one:
a. Leucippus and Democritus
b. Anaximander and Anaximenes
c. Pythagoras and Thales
d. Heraclitus and Parmenides - ANSWER: A
